Resolving Issues With Meia Cassandra

by ADMIN 37 views

Meia Cassandra is a powerful NoSQL database, but like any complex system, it can encounter issues. Understanding these issues and how to resolve them is crucial for maintaining a healthy and efficient database environment. — Is Lionel Messi's Father Still Alive? A Close Look

Common Meia Cassandra Issues

  • Performance Bottlenecks: Slow read or write speeds can significantly impact application performance.
  • Data Inconsistencies: Discrepancies in data across different nodes can lead to incorrect results.
  • Node Failures: Individual node failures can disrupt the cluster's availability and data integrity.
  • Storage Issues: Running out of disk space or experiencing disk I/O bottlenecks can cripple the database.
  • Configuration Errors: Incorrect settings can lead to various problems, including performance degradation and instability.

Resolving Meia Cassandra Issues

Performance Tuning

To address performance bottlenecks:

  • Optimize Queries: Ensure your queries are efficient and use appropriate indexes.
  • Adjust Memory Settings: Allocate sufficient memory to Cassandra based on your workload.
  • Monitor Resource Usage: Regularly check CPU, memory, and disk I/O to identify bottlenecks.
  • Tune Garbage Collection: Optimize garbage collection settings to reduce pauses and improve throughput.

Addressing Data Inconsistencies

To resolve data inconsistencies:

  • Run Repairs: Use the nodetool repair command to synchronize data across nodes.
  • Check Consistency Levels: Ensure your read and write operations use appropriate consistency levels.
  • Monitor Replication: Verify that data is being replicated correctly to all nodes.

Handling Node Failures

To manage node failures:

  • Implement Redundancy: Ensure your cluster has enough nodes to tolerate failures.
  • Use Automatic Failover: Configure Cassandra to automatically replace failed nodes.
  • Monitor Node Health: Regularly check the status of each node in the cluster.

Managing Storage Issues

To prevent storage issues:

  • Monitor Disk Space: Regularly check disk space usage and add capacity as needed.
  • Optimize Data Compaction: Tune compaction settings to reduce storage overhead.
  • Use Efficient Data Models: Design your data models to minimize storage requirements.

Correcting Configuration Errors

To avoid configuration errors:

  • Review Configuration Files: Carefully review all Cassandra configuration files for errors.
  • Use Configuration Management Tools: Employ tools like Ansible or Chef to manage configurations consistently.
  • Test Configuration Changes: Always test configuration changes in a non-production environment first.

Monitoring Meia Cassandra

Regular monitoring is essential for identifying and resolving issues proactively. Key metrics to monitor include: — Homemade Soup: How Long Does It Last In The Fridge?

  • Latency: Measure read and write latency to detect performance problems.
  • Throughput: Track the number of operations per second to assess overall performance.
  • Error Rates: Monitor error rates to identify potential issues.
  • Resource Usage: Track CPU, memory, and disk I/O utilization.

By understanding common Meia Cassandra issues and implementing appropriate monitoring and troubleshooting strategies, you can ensure a stable and efficient database environment. — Mark Andrew Kozlowski: Life, Career, And Impact